FAQ's of 2650 4FLUTE BALLNOSE COPPER 55HRC TiCN COATED:


Q: How does the TiCN coating enhance the tool life of the 2650 4FLUTE BALLNOSE end mill?

A: The Titanium Carbonitride (TiCN) coating significantly increases the hardness and wear resistance of the end mill, leading to an extended tool life even when used on demanding materials such as steel or cast iron.

Q: What materials is this end mill suitable for?

A: This tool is suitable for milling copper, alloy steel, tool steel, mold steel, cast iron, and graphite, making it versatile for various precision cutting applications.

Q: What are the usage benefits of selecting a 4-flute ballnose end mill for milling operations?

A: A 4-flute ballnose design offers smoother surface finishes, more efficient material removal, and better contouring in 3D machining tasks, especially on complex mold and die surfaces.
